随着移动互联网的快速发展,h5小程序也成为了应用程序的重要领域。新河h5小程序是一款功能强大、操作简便的开发工具,不仅适用于企业应用,也适用于个人开发。本文就掌握新河h5小程序的高级开发技能进行详细讲解,帮助开发者更快、更稳地进阶。
1.了解新河h5小程序的基础知识
在掌握新河h5小程序的高级开发技能之前,我们首先需要了解新河h5小程序的基础知识。新河h5小程序是一款轻量级的应用程序,它具有独立的应用界面和完整的应用功能,但是相比于传统的应用程序,它的资源占用更小、更灵活,适合于在移动端应用中使用。新河h5小程序采用HTML5、CSS3、JS等多种前端技术开发,因此对前端工程师的开发技能有很高的要求。
2.掌握新河h5小程序的组件库和API库
新河h5小程序的组件库和API库是开发新河h5小程序的重要工具。组件库包括组件元素、事件回调等,它能够帮助开发者实现应用程序的交互逻辑和视觉效果,提高开发效率和应用性能。API库则提供了各类基础函数接口,如数据存储、网络通信、音视频播放等,帮助开发者快速实现应用功能,降低开发成本。
3.学习新河h5小程序的高级开发技巧
要掌握新河h5小程序的高级开发技能,我们需要具备扎实的前端编程基础,了解H5和CSS3等前端技术,并且能够熟练应用JavaScript编写高质量的代码。同时,我们还应该学习如何进行调试和测试,以保证程序的稳定性和性能。在使用新河h5小程序进行开发时,我们可以采用各种优化技巧,如减少DOM操作次数、优化渲染效率、缓存数据等,来提高应用程序的性能和用户体验。
4.使用新河h5小程序进行企业应用开发
新河h5小程序可以广泛应用于各种企业应用场景,如电商平台、金融服务、医疗健康等。在企业应用开发中,我们需要了解企业应用的业务逻辑和用户需求,并且选择合适的组件和API库进行开发。同时,我们还需要注意应用程序的安全性和数据保护,采用安全加密和授权认证等技术保障用户信息的安全。
5.个人开发者使用新河h5小程序进行创意开发
除了企业应用开发,新河h5小程序还适用于个人开发者进行创意开发,如小游戏、艺术创作等。在创意开发中,我们可以充分发挥自己的创意和想象力,将各种前沿技术和艺术手法融合到应用程序中,打造出具有个性和特色的应用作品。在个人开发者的创意开发中,我们也需要注重应用程序的稳定性和用户体验,确保应用程序能够受到用户的欢迎和关注。
掌握新河h5小程序的高级开发技能是一个不断学习和实践的过程,也是一个提高自身技术水平和创意能力的很好机会。我们可以与其他开发者进行交流和分享,通过各种渠道获取前沿技术和动态信息,提高自己的开发技能和视野。同时,我们也要关注应用程序的社会责任,尊重用户隐私和权利,加强应用程序的安全管理和数据保护。让我们一起致力于打造更加智慧和美好的移动互联网世界!
随着移动互联网的快速发展,越来越多的企业开始将业务转移到移动端,而H5小程序正是其中的一种重要方式。作为一种轻量级、快速开发、跨平台的技术,H5小程序成为了移动端开发的热门选择。而新河H5小程序中,更是集成了许多高级开发技能,需要开发者掌握才能更好地实现技术层面的优化和性能提升。本文将详细介绍“掌握“新河H5小程序”的高级开发技能,进阶更快更稳!”这一主题,从多个方面深度解析新河H5小程序的高级开发技能。
1. 学习优化H5小程序的性能
优化H5小程序的性能是开发者应该掌握的第一个高级开发技能。通过学习H5小程序的性能知识,开发者可以更好地了解小程序在运行过程中可能存在的性能问题,以及如何通过优化来减少小程序的卡顿、延迟等现象。在新河H5小程序中,开发者需要掌握的性能优化技能包括如下几个方面:
1.1 图片优化
在H5小程序中,图片是必不可少的元素,而且往往会成为影响小程序性能的关键因素。因此,开发者应该学习如何优化小程序中的图片,包括如何压缩、合并、延迟加载等操作。
1.2 代码优化
除了图片外,小程序中的代码也是影响性能的重要因素。开发者应该了解小程序的运行机制,并通过代码优化来减少代码的执行时间,从而达到优化性能的目的。
1.3 内存优化
小程序在运行过程中会占用一定的内存资源,而内存资源的不足会导致小程序出现崩溃、卡顿等现象。因此,开发者应该掌握内存的使用规则,通过合理使用内存来优化小程序的性能。
2. 学习集成第三方库和框架
除了性能优化外,集成第三方库和框架也是开发者应该掌握的高级开发技能。通过集成第三方库和框架,开发者可以快速实现小程序中的复杂功能,并且能够提高小程序的开发效率和质量。
2.1 学习如何安装和使用第三方库
在新河H5小程序中,开发者需要掌握如何安装和使用第三方库,这些库包括样式库、动画库、数据可视化库等。在掌握这些库的使用方法后,开发者可以更加轻松地实现小程序的各种功能。
2.2 学习如何集成框架
框架是指一种前端架构,它提供了一系列的工具、组件和模块来帮助开发者快速构建小程序。在新河H5小程序中,开发者需要掌握多种框架的使用方法,包括Vue.js、React.js等。
3. 学习调试和测试技巧
调试和测试是每一个开发者都需要掌握的技能,只有通过测试和调试才能保证小程序的质量。在新河H5小程序中,开发者需要掌握多种调试和测试技巧,包括如何使用Chrome调试工具、如何进行单元测试等。
3.1 Chrome调试工具
Chrome调试工具是一款非常流行的前端调试工具,它可以帮助开发者快速定位小程序中的各种问题,包括有关DOM、CSS、JavaScript等方面的问题。开发者需要掌握Chrome调试工具的使用方法,包括如何断点调试、如何查看变量值等。
3.2 单元测试
单元测试是指对代码中最小的可测试部分进行测试的技术。在新河H5小程序中,单元测试可以帮助开发者提高代码的质量和稳定性。开发者需要了解如何编写正确的测试用例,并且掌握如何使用测试框架和测试工具。
4. 学习版本控制技术
版本控制技术是每一个开发者都必须掌握的技能。通过版本控制技术,开发者可以更好地管理小程序的源代码,并且可以跟踪代码的变化。在新河H5小程序中,开发者需要掌握如何使用Git进行版本控制。
4.1 Git的基本概念
Git是一种分布式版本控制系统,它可以让开发者很容易地跟踪代码的变化。在开始学习Git之前,开发者需要了解Git的基本概念,包括仓库、分支、提交、合并等。
4.2 使用Git进行版本控制
在掌握Git的基本概念后,开发者需要学习如何使用Git进行版本控制。这包括如何创建Git仓库、如何提交代码、如何合并分支等。
5. 学习如何发布和部署小程序
发布和部署小程序是每一个开发者都必须了解的技能。通过学习如何发布和部署小程序,开发者可以让自己的小程序更加稳定和可靠。在新河H5小程序中,开发者需要掌握如何发布和部署小程序,包括如何打包和上传小程序、如何配置服务器等。
5.1 打包和上传小程序
在发布和部署小程序之前,开发者需要通过打包来生成小程序的可执行代码,并且需要上传到服务器。在新河H5小程序中,开发者需要了解如何进行打包和上传操作。
5.2 配置服务器
在部署小程序的过程中,开发者需要配置服务器,从而可以实现小程序的访问。在新河H5小程序中,开发者需要掌握如何配置服务器,包括如何进行域名解析、如何配置Nginx等。
以上就是本文介绍的“掌握“新河H5小程序”的高级开发技能,进阶更快更稳!”的内容。通过学习本文介绍的多种高级开发技能,开发者可以更好地实现小程序的开发和优化,从而提高小程序的性能和质量。希望本文的介绍能够帮助到各位开发者,让大家在移动端开发的道路上越走越远!